Urban centers see double-digit increases in office attendance

Mar 20, 2025
Office attendance is on the rise with year-over-year increases across several major city centers—see which cities and industries are leading the charge.

As businesses continue to adapt to evolving work models, February 2025 saw another shift in workplace dynamics. New data indicates a 19.64%  year-over-year increase in office entries per company, underscoring a steady movement toward in-person collaboration.

Which cities are leading the office revival?

Urban centers across the U.S. are experiencing a renewed office presence. Some cities have witnessed double-digit increases in office entries per company compared to the same time last year.

  • Austin: 71.32% increase 
  • Chicago: 50.52% increase 
  • Los Angeles: 28.33% increase 
  • New York City: 17.94% increase 
  • San Francisco: 11.91% increase 
  • Washington DC: 7.42% increase

Austin experienced the most significant increase, with a staggering 71.32% rise in office entries. This surge can be attributed to the city's growing business ecosystem, an influx of tech companies, and a broader return-to-office push by major employers.

Industry breakdown: Who’s returning faster?

Office attendance trends vary widely across industries. Comparing February 2024 to February 2025, here’s how different sectors performed in total office entries:

  • Technology: 9.67% increase
  • Pharma and Biotech: 9.39% increase
  • Manufacturing: 9.01% increase
  • Food and Beverage + Consumer Goods: 7.53% increase
  • Professional Services: 11.29% increase

The Professional Services sector led the way with an 11.29% increase in office attendance. This rise reflects a strategic emphasis on in-person collaboration for client meetings, team productivity, and professional development opportunities.

The road ahead for office work

With office attendance steadily climbing, businesses must rethink their workplace strategies. Employee experience, flexible policies, and workplace design will be key to sustaining this momentum.

The companies that succeed will be those that create environments where employees feel productive, engaged, and motivated to collaborate in person.
